Overview
The TMS320F28035RSHT is a member of the Piccolo™ family of microcontrollers from Texas Instruments. This device is built around the high-efficiency 32-bit TMS320C28x CPU, which operates at 60 MHz with a cycle time of 16.67 ns. It integrates a Control Law Accelerator (CLA) and various control peripherals, making it suitable for applications requiring high performance and low power consumption.
The microcontroller is designed for code compatibility with previous C28x-based code and offers a high level of analog integration. It features an internal voltage regulator for single-rail operation, enhancements to the High-Resolution PWM (HRPWM) for dual-edge control, and analog comparators with internal 10-bit references.
Key Specifications
Specification | Details |
---|---|
CPU | High-Efficiency 32-Bit TMS320C28x |
Operating Frequency | 60 MHz (16.67-ns Cycle Time) |
MAC Operations | 16 × 16 and 32 × 32, 16 × 16 Dual MAC |
Bus Architecture | Harvard Bus Architecture |
CLA | Programmable Control Law Accelerator with 32-Bit Floating-Point Math Accelerator |
Endianness | Little Endian |
Power Supply | Single 3.3-V Supply, No Power Sequencing Requirement |
Reset | Integrated Power-On Reset and Brown-Out Reset |
GPIO Pins | Up to 45 Individually Programmable, Multiplexed GPIO Pins |
Timers | Three 32-Bit CPU Timers, Independent 16-Bit Timer in Each ePWM |
Memory | Flash, SARAM, OTP, Boot ROM Available |
Package | 56-Pin RSH Very Thin Quad Flatpack (No Lead) VQFN |
Temperature Range | –40°C to 125°C |
Key Features
- High-Efficiency 32-Bit CPU with 16 × 16 and 32 × 32 MAC Operations
- Programmable Control Law Accelerator (CLA) with 32-Bit Floating-Point Math Accelerator
- Fast Interrupt Response and Processing, Unified Memory Programming Model
- Enhanced Control Peripherals: ePWM, HRPWM, eCAP, HRCAP, eQEP
- Analog-to-Digital Converter (ADC), On-Chip Temperature Sensor, Comparator
- Serial Port Peripherals: SCI, SPI, I2C, LIN, eCAN
- Advanced Emulation Features: Analysis and Breakpoint Functions, Real-Time Debug Through Hardware
- Code-Security Module with 128-Bit Security Key and Lock
- Low Power Consumption, Single 3.3-V Supply, No Power Sequencing Requirement
Applications
The TMS320F28035RSHT is designed to support a wide range of applications, including:
- Defense and Aerospace: Controlled baseline, extended temperature range (–55°C to 125°C), and extended product life cycle.
- Medical Applications: High reliability and extended product life cycle.
- Automotive Applications: AEC Q100 qualification, extended temperature range (–40°C to 125°C).
- Industrial Control Systems: High-performance control, low power consumption, and advanced emulation features.
Q & A
- What is the operating frequency of the TMS320F28035RSHT?
The operating frequency is 60 MHz with a cycle time of 16.67 ns.
- What is the Control Law Accelerator (CLA) in the TMS320F28035RSHT?
The CLA is a programmable accelerator that includes a 32-bit floating-point math accelerator and executes code independently of the main CPU.
- What types of memory are available on the TMS320F28035RSHT?
The device features Flash, SARAM, OTP, and Boot ROM.
- What is the package type for the TMS320F28035RSHT?
The package type is a 56-Pin RSH Very Thin Quad Flatpack (No Lead) VQFN.
- What are the key enhanced control peripherals available on this microcontroller?
The key enhanced control peripherals include ePWM, HRPWM, eCAP, HRCAP, and eQEP.
- Does the TMS320F28035RSHT support real-time debugging?
Yes, it supports real-time debug through hardware with advanced emulation features.
- What is the temperature range for the TMS320F28035RSHT?
The device operates in an extended temperature range of –40°C to 125°C.
- What security features are included in the TMS320F28035RSHT?
The device includes a Code-Security Module with a 128-Bit Security Key and Lock to protect secure memory blocks and prevent firmware reverse engineering.
- What serial port peripherals are available on the TMS320F28035RSHT?
The device includes SCI, SPI, I2C, LIN, and eCAN modules.
- Is the TMS320F28035RSHT suitable for automotive applications?
Yes, it is AEC Q100 qualified for automotive applications and operates in an extended temperature range.